What's Happening?
Astronomers have identified a candidate gas giant planet orbiting Alpha Centauri A, the nearest star resembling our Sun, using the James Webb Space Telescope. This discovery has sparked interest due to its resemblance to the fictional moon Pandora from the Avatar movies. The planet orbits at a distance where temperatures might be suitable for life, according to reports accepted by The Astrophysical Journal Letters. Scientists speculate that the planet could have moons, potentially offering environments conducive to life. However, the existence of a lush, complex ecosystem like Pandora remains uncertain.

What's Next?
Further observations are needed to confirm the existence of the candidate planet and its characteristics. If confirmed, scientists may focus on detecting moons and assessing their habitability. This could involve using advanced telescopes and instruments to study the planet's atmosphere and potential moons. The discovery may prompt discussions among astronomers and space agencies about prioritizing missions to Alpha Centauri A, given its proximity and potential for groundbreaking discoveries.
